How they compare
Senegal currently reports 5.4% against 5.1% in China, a difference of 0.3%.
That makes Senegal's figure about 1.1 times China's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 31 shared years of data; in 1994 it was China ahead.
China ranks 81st and Senegal ranks 78th of 161 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, China averaged higher in 2 and Senegal in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| China | Senegal |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 14.0% | 8.6% | 5.4% | China |
| 2000s | 10.1% | 6.4% | 3.7% | China |
| 2010s | 5.7% | 5.9% | 0.2% | Senegal |
| 2020s | 5.0% | 5.8% | 0.8% | Senegal |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
